博客 轻量化数据中台设计与实现关键技术探讨

轻量化数据中台设计与实现关键技术探讨

   数栈君   发表于 2025-07-24 13:37  90  0

轻量化数据中台设计与实现关键技术探讨

随着企业数字化转型的深入推进,数据中台作为连接业务与数据的核心平台,其重要性日益凸显。传统的数据中台在功能和性能上虽然强大,但往往伴随着资源消耗高、架构复杂、维护成本高等问题。因此,轻量化数据中台的概念应运而生,旨在通过优化技术架构和设计原则,实现高效、灵活、低成本的数据处理与管理。本文将深入探讨轻量化数据中台的设计理念、关键技术及其在企业中的应用。


一、轻量化数据中台的概述

轻量化数据中台是一种以“轻量化”为核心理念的数据管理平台,旨在通过简化架构、降低资源消耗和提高效率,满足企业对实时性、灵活性和成本效益的更高要求。与传统数据中台相比,轻量化数据中台更加注重模块化设计、微服务架构和边缘计算等技术的应用,从而在确保数据处理能力的同时,显著降低硬件资源和运维成本。

轻量化数据中台的核心目标是为企业提供快速部署、易于扩展和高效运行的数据处理能力,同时支持实时数据流处理和复杂的数据分析需求。其优势在于能够适应不同规模的企业和行业的多样化需求,尤其是在资源有限的中小型企业中展现出显著的价值。


二、轻量化数据中台的设计原则

1. 模块化设计

模块化设计是轻量化数据中台的基础原则之一。通过将数据处理、存储、计算、分析和可视化等功能模块化,企业可以根据实际需求灵活选择和配置模块,避免不必要的功能冗余。这种设计不仅提高了系统的可维护性和扩展性,还降低了整体资源消耗。

2. 轻量化架构

轻量化架构强调使用轻量级的技术栈和工具,例如基于云原生的微服务架构、轻量级数据库和消息队列等。这种架构减少了系统对硬件资源的依赖,提高了资源利用率,同时支持快速部署和弹性扩展。

3. 数据治理与实时性优化

轻量化数据中台注重数据的实时性和高效性,通过引入流处理技术(如Flink)和边缘计算,实现数据的实时分析和处理。同时,数据治理功能的引入确保了数据的准确性和一致性,为企业提供可靠的数据支持。

4. 可扩展性和灵活性

轻量化数据中台的设计充分考虑了未来扩展性,支持多种数据源的接入、多种计算框架的集成以及灵活的部署方式。这种灵活性使得企业能够根据业务需求快速调整数据中台的功能。


三、轻量化数据中台实现的关键技术

1. 流处理技术

流处理技术是实现轻量化数据中台的核心技术之一。通过实时处理数据流,企业能够快速响应业务变化,例如在智能制造中实时监控生产线状态,及时发现和解决问题。

2. 边缘计算

边缘计算将数据处理能力从云端延伸至边缘设备,减少了数据传输延迟,提高了处理效率。这种技术在物联网和实时监控场景中尤为重要。

3. 云原生技术

云原生技术(如容器化和Kubernetes)为轻量化数据中台提供了弹性计算资源和自动化运维能力,显著降低了运维成本并提高了系统的可靠性和扩展性。

4. 轻量级数据库

轻量级数据库(如分布式数据库和NoSQL)在轻量化中台中发挥着重要作用,支持高效的读写操作和数据存储,同时降低了资源消耗。

5. 数据虚拟化

数据虚拟化技术允许企业通过虚拟层统一访问和管理多源数据,无需进行物理数据集成,从而降低了数据整合的复杂性和成本。

6. 容器化部署

容器化部署(如Docker和Kubernetes)使得轻量化数据中台的部署和运维更加高效,支持快速迭代和弹性扩展。


四、轻量化数据中台的实现方案

1. 模块划分与技术选型

在设计轻量化数据中台时,首先需要根据业务需求进行模块划分,例如数据采集模块、数据处理模块、数据存储模块和数据可视化模块。然后,选择适合的轻量级技术栈,例如基于Flink的流处理框架和基于Kubernetes的容器编排平台。

2. 架构设计与优化

轻量化数据中台的架构设计需要充分考虑模块间的通信、数据的流动和系统的可扩展性。通过引入微服务架构和事件驱动设计,可以实现高效的模块协作和系统优化。

3. 数据治理与安全

数据治理和安全是轻量化数据中台不可忽视的重要部分。通过引入数据目录、访问控制和数据脱敏等技术,企业可以确保数据的安全性和合规性。

4. 性能调优与监控

通过性能调优和监控,企业可以实时了解数据中台的运行状态,及时发现和解决潜在问题。例如,通过监控工具(如Prometheus)实时监控系统的资源使用情况和性能指标。

5. 安全防护与容错机制

轻量化数据中台需要具备强大的安全防护和容错机制,以应对数据丢失、网络中断和系统故障等风险。通过引入备份恢复、冗余设计和高可用架构,可以显著提高系统的稳定性。


五、轻量化数据中台的应用场景

1. 智能制造

在智能制造中,轻量化数据中台可以实时处理生产数据,优化生产线的运行效率,提高产品质量和生产效率。

2. 智慧交通

通过轻量化数据中台,智慧交通系统可以实时监控交通流量和道路状态,优化交通信号灯控制,减少拥堵和事故发生。

3. 实时监控与告警

轻量化数据中台支持实时数据流处理和告警功能,帮助企业及时发现和处理系统故障,保障业务的连续运行。

4. 数据驱动决策

轻量化数据中台为企业提供了丰富的数据可视化和分析功能,支持基于数据的决策制定,提升企业的竞争力。


六、未来趋势与挑战

1. 轻量化数据中台的未来趋势

  1. 与AI技术的深度融合:通过引入AI技术,轻量化数据中台可以实现智能数据处理和自动化决策,进一步提升数据处理效率。
  2. 边缘计算的深化应用:随着5G和物联网技术的发展,边缘计算将在轻量化数据中台中发挥越来越重要的作用。
  3. 实时性与高效性的进一步提升:通过引入更高效的计算框架和算法,轻量化数据中台的实时性和处理能力将得到进一步提升。
  4. 开源社区的崛起:开源技术的普及将进一步推动轻量化数据中台的发展,为企业提供更多选择和灵活性。
  5. 行业标准的制定与推广:随着轻量化数据中台的应用越来越广泛,行业标准的制定和推广将有助于规范市场,促进行业健康发展。

2. 挑战与应对策略

  1. 技术复杂性:轻量化数据中台的设计和实现需要综合考虑多种技术的融合,这对技术团队的能力提出了更高要求。企业可以通过引入专业人才和培训来应对这一挑战。
  2. 数据安全与隐私保护:随着数据中台的应用越来越广泛,数据安全和隐私保护问题日益凸显。企业需要引入更强大的数据安全技术,例如数据加密、访问控制和隐私计算等。
  3. 资源限制与成本控制:轻量化数据中台的目标之一是降低成本,但在实际应用中,企业仍需要投入一定的资源来保证系统的稳定运行。企业可以通过优化资源管理和采用云原生技术来降低运营成本。
  4. 行业需求的多样性:不同行业对数据中台的需求存在差异,企业需要根据自身的业务特点和需求,灵活调整数据中台的功能和架构。

七、结语

轻量化数据中台作为一种新兴的数据管理平台,以其高效、灵活和低成本的特点,正在逐步取代传统数据中台,成为企业数字化转型的重要工具。通过采用模块化设计、轻量化架构和先进 technologies,轻量化数据中台能够帮助企业实现数据的高效处理和管理,支持实时决策和业务创新。

如果您对如何构建轻量化数据中台感兴趣,或希望了解更多相关技术实现,请访问我们的官方网站 DataStack 申请试用,了解更多详细信息。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料